
Browning Miroku Model BPR22 BPR 22 LR 20″ Blue Pump Action Rifle MFD 1977

Make: Browning, Miroku
Model: BPR 22
Serial Number: 01634RR176
Year of Manufacture: 1977
Caliber: .22 Long Rifle
Action Type: Pump Action with Tubular Magazine
Markings: The right side of the receiver is marked with the serial number. The butt plate is marked “BROWNING”. The right side of the barrel is marked “BPR-22 CALIBER 22 LONG RIFLE ONLY”. The left side of the barrel is marked “BROWNING ARMS COMPANY MORGAN UTAH & MONTREAL P.Q. / MADE IN JAPAN”.
Barrel Length: Approximately 20 ¼”
Sights / Optics: The front sight is a dovetail set, beaded blade. The rear sight is a dovetail set flip up “U” notch marked with a white “triangle” and hash marks. It is adjustable for elevation. The receiver is grooved for an integral scope mount.
Stock Configuration & Condition: The two piece stock is checkered high gloss wood with a pistol grip, straight comb, and a black synthetic buttplate. The wood shows infrequently dispersed light draglines, small nicks, and shallow compressions. There are no chips or cracks. The checkering is sharp. The LOP measures 13 5/8” from the front of the trigger to the back of the butt plate, which shows faint wear. The stock rates in about Fine-Excellent overall condition.
Type of Finish: Blue
Finish Originality: Original
Bore Condition: The bore is bright and the rifling is sharp. There is no erosion.
Overall Condition: This rifle retains about 98% of its metal finish. There are a few sparsely scattered nicks and scratches throughout the barrel and receiver. The screw heads are intact. The markings are deep. Overall, this rifle rates in about Fine-Excellent condition.
Mechanics: The action functions correctly. We have not fired this rifle. As with all previously owned firearms, a thorough cleaning may be necessary to meet your maintenance standards.

Our Assessment: This is a nifty little Browning BPR. These were only made from 1977 to 1982 so you won’t see many around; especially in this condition. This example is from the first year of manufacture in 1977. This rifle is in Fine-Excellent condition with a great bore and excellent mechanics.
